Primary Purpose of Position

North Carolina Central University Division of Institutional Advancement seeks an experienced team member to guide the Corporate & Foundation Relations platform. The Director will develop and execute a plan to identify, cultivate, solicit, and steward corporate and foundation prospects and donors, and implement grant strategies to meet or exceed goals and expand philanthropic support. The successful candidate will serve as the leading author for most grant proposals and build relationships with the corporate and foundation community in the Research Triangle area and beyond.

Responsibilities and Duties

Primary Responsibilities and Duties

  • Identify, cultivate, solicit and steward public and private corporations and regional
    ational foundations to secure gifts or grants for NCCU’s priorities and initiatives.
  • Ensure timely development, submission, and management of grant and sponsorship proposals, including event sponsorships for signature programs; track, acknowledge, steward, and report to institutional partners.
  • Directly manage a portfolio of 50-75 corporate and foundation funders, including key existing and prospective donors, to create cases for support.

Function: Coordination – Operations

  • Manage relationships with institutional supporters by providing updates, site visits, and meetings that advance these relationships.
  • Collaborate with administration, faculty, development officers, academic and athletic programs, research centers and institutes to increase philanthropic support.

Function: Administrative

  • Conduct prospect research and use donor management systems to track corporate and foundation donor information in Raiser's Edge, including data entry and analytic reporting.
  • Manage the corporate partners program to ensure active engagement and benefits for partners.
  • Directly manage a portfolio of corporations and foundations across NCCU programs and services.
